Brown Derby. The Brown Derby cocktail effortlessly marries the robust flavors of bourbon with the tang of fresh grapefruit juice and the subtle sweetness of honey syrup. Simple to serve, this cocktail is accessible to all. Just mix the ingredients, strain into a glass, and garnish with a twist of grapefruit peel.

Lime and pineapple. Squeeze the juice of a lime into a tall glass, add two tablespoonfuls of plain syrup and one tablespoonful of pineapple syrup. Mix well, add shaved ice, fill up the glass with carbonated water, and at the same time put in a teaspoonful of cherry juice. Garnish with a slice of orange, and serve with straws.

Rum was one of the hottest commodities during Prohibition and one of the hottest drinks was the Mary Pickford. Inspired by a Hollywood legend and created in Cuba, this cocktail is sweet and tropical. It mixes light rum, pineapple juice, and grenadine to create a beautiful pink drink . Continue to 5 of 15 below. 05 of 15.

How (and When) to Serve a Sidecar . The sidecar is great as a before- or after-dinner drink, so serve it anytime you want. The cocktail is typically served in a chilled cocktail glass.A popular embellishment first mentioned in recipes from the early 1930s, a sugar-rimmed glass, adds a sweet contrast to the sour drink.

Harry was a collector of cocktail recipes. In 1930 at the request of the Savoy, he compiled The Savoy Cocktail Book.It was a collection of over 2,000 recipes that Craddock compiled from his years as a bartender. 86 years later, The Savoy Cocktail Book is still in print and is still known one of the most important cocktail books of the 20 th century.

Martini. The classic martini was trendy in the 20s as well. It was often made with bathtub gin, where the vermouth made awful gin tolerable. Plus, the martini is a potent drink and was a great one for getting people drunk fast. Modern martinis are often heavy on the gin, sometimes using hardly any vermouth.
